Deborah Bowie Returns to Birmingham Civil Rights Institute

Deborah Bowie, a seasoned professional with a rich history in Birmingham, returns as the new president and CEO of the Birmingham Civil Rights Institute. After years of honing her skills in local news, public service, and leadership roles, Bowie is poised to tackle the institutes challenges, including aging infrastructure, outdated exhibits, and reduced staff. Her plans include fresh galleries, modern technology, stronger fundraising, and expanded programs, all aimed at preserving civil rights history and engaging the next generation. Bowies personal journey, marked by overcoming family hardships and advocating for marginalized groups, fuels her passion for this role. With her arrival, she brings a wealth of experience and a commitment to revitalizing the institute.
